The name that gives it recognition is called the name of the domain.  The name of the domain is also referred to as URL, but they both are not the same. When you plan to pick up your own name for the domain you must first confirm its availability for which you must research.

If available you may purchase the name via a domain registration site, a rostrum which you can search for on the internet. These providers provide a search facility online free of charge. When you are on their site type the name of your choice, if it is available you can buy it.

When you want to Buy Domains from a registrar, the site will register your name for a fee. The domains must be listed with the online Corporation for Assigned Names and numbers which are also referred to as ICANN. The formalities of registration for domain names include your details like your address, name, and your cell number.

You may search for a name on the internet and find out if the names desired are available with WHOIS. Some people prefer to sell the extra names they have. If you feel that purchasing a name from the directory is more economical than purchasing a new name you could do so.

Once you have paid the amount to the reseller he has to complete the formalities, for transferring the rights from his name to your name. Even if you prefer to transfer your domain name to another user you may do so through a domain name registrar. You may even change the domain name registrar. Certain registrars offer cheaper domain name services and provide you other add on services such as web hosting.

The law permits domain name transfer, but the procedure takes a little time for the verification process.
